| New Brighton Unable to Hold Powerful Caldy | |
New Brighton went down to a well organised Caldy side on Saturday giving Caldy the double in this season's campaign. The Blues with a relatively young side, some playing in positions forced by necesity rather than choice, were out muscled by a more mature streetwise team whose game was centered around a solid pack with some very capable ball carriers. Manager Steve Dakin comments that although there are some talented youngsters in the side they have difficulty co-ordinating as a team for two main reasons.
Substitites Marc Simon, Danny Hayes and Kyle Hesketh came on as replacements. With both the First Team and the Second's deep in the relegation zone of their respective league competitions there needs to to be some hard work to be done, on and off the field, if we are to avoid a total whitewash.
Full Time Score: Caldy 2nd 32 - 0 New Brighton 2nd
